`
bei-jin-520
  • 浏览: 110589 次
  • 性别: Icon_minigender_1
  • 来自: 深圳
社区版块
存档分类
最新评论

多选框赋值给隐藏表单域

    博客分类:
  • JS
 
阅读更多

<form   name="frm">  
  <input   type="checkbox"   name="a"   value="冰箱"   onclick="checkItem();">冰箱
  <input   type="checkbox"   name="a"   value="电脑"   onclick="checkItem();">电脑
  <input   type="checkbox"   name="a"   value="洗衣机"   onclick="checkItem();">洗衣机  
  <input   type="hidden"   name="b">  
  </form>  
  <script>  
  function   checkItem(){  
  var   chkbox=document.getElementsByName("a");  
  var   v="";  
  for(var   i=0;i<chkbox.length;i++){  
  if(chkbox[i].checked)   v+=","+chkbox[i].value;  
  }  
  document.frm.b.value=v.replace(/^,{1}/,"");  
  }  
  </script>

这样就得到一个字符串传入到后台用spilt函数进行分割得到一个字符串数组。

分享到:
评论

相关推荐

    Jquery 表单取值赋值的一些基本操作

    对于下拉框、单选框和多选框,我们同样可以利用 JQuery 来获取和设置它们的值。 **示例代码:** ```javascript // 获取下拉框选中项的文本 var cc1 = $(".formcselect option:selected").text(); // 获取单选按钮...

    Web开发1

    - `type='checkbox'` 创建复选框,用户可以选择多个。 - `type='radio'` 创建单选按钮,同一组内的`name`属性值相同,用户只能选择一个。 - `type='file'` 允许用户选择本地文件。 - `type='submit'` 提交表单,触发...

    ASP.NET的网页代码模型及生命周期

    在创建时,去掉【将代码放在单独的文件中】复选框的选择即可创建单文件页模型的ASP.NET文件。创建后文件会自动创建相应的HTML代码以便页面的初始化,示例代码如下所示。 “C#” %&gt; &lt;!DOCTYPE html PUBLIC “-//W3C/...

    《javaScrip开发技术大全》源代码

    • sample02.htm 将函数返回值赋值给对象属性 • sample03.htm 将函数的返回值作为数据在表达式中进行运算 • sample04.htm 直接将函数的返回值输出 • sample05.htm 通过事件调用...

    软件开发技术常用术语英中对照

    ### 软件开发技术常用术语英中对照 ...**复选框**:用户界面中的控件,允许用户选择一个或多个选项。 #### Checkbutton **单选按钮**:用户界面中的控件,一次只能选择一个选项。 #### CHECK Constraints ...

    PHP开发实战1200例(第1卷).(清华出版.潘凯华.刘中华).part1

    实例173 实现复选框中的全选、反选和不选 208 实例174 隐藏域提交用户的ID值 210 实例175 图像域替代提交按钮 211 实例176 跳转菜单实现页面跳转 213 实例177 上传图片预览 214 实例178 去掉下拉选项的边框 215 实例...

    PHP开发实战1200例(第1卷).(清华出版.潘凯华.刘中华).part2

    实例173 实现复选框中的全选、反选和不选 208 实例174 隐藏域提交用户的ID值 210 实例175 图像域替代提交按钮 211 实例176 跳转菜单实现页面跳转 213 实例177 上传图片预览 214 实例178 去掉下拉选项的边框 215 实例...

    2021-2022计算机二级等级考试试题及答案No.13101.docx

    `&lt;input type="checkbox"&gt;`:创建复选框。 - D. `&lt;input type="radio"&gt;`:创建单选按钮。 - **正确答案:A** —— 创建普通文本框。 ### 7. Access数据库文件格式 **知识点概述:** Microsoft Access 数据库...

    php网络开发完全手册

    11.1.4 单选框与复选框 169 11.1.5 多行文本域标签textarea 171 11.1.6 下拉框与列表框标签select 172 11.2 表单数据的接收 173 11.2.1 GET方法 173 11.2.2 POST方法 176 11.3 常用表单数据的验证方法 177 11.3.1 ...

    C#编程经验技巧宝典

    24 &lt;br&gt;0050 using关键字的用法 24 &lt;br&gt;0051 变量的作用域 25 &lt;br&gt;2.5 其他 26 &lt;br&gt;0052 有效使用this对象 26 &lt;br&gt;0053 如何声明变量 26 &lt;br&gt;0054 如何声明相同类型的多个变量 26 ...

    jQuery完全实例.rar

    隐藏一个表单中所有元素。 jQuery 代码: $(myForm.elements).hide() jQuery(callback)jQuery(callback) $(document).ready()的简写。 允许你绑定一个在DOM文档载入完成后执行的函数。这个函数的作用如同$...

    大名鼎鼎SWFUpload- Flash+JS 上传

     file_queue_limit : 2, 上传队列数量限制,该项通常不需设置,会根据file_upload_limit自动赋值  flash_url : "http://www.swfupload.org/swfupload_f9.swf", Flash控件的URL  flash_width : "1px",  flash_...

Global site tag (gtag.js) - Google Analytics